UNM Overwhelms UT Arlington 74-56 as Defense Fuels 2-0 Start

A 23-turnover haul produced 32 points at The Pit before the largest crowd of Eric Olen's tenure.

  • Freshman Tomislav Buljan led New Mexico with 17 points, including 13 after halftime in a decisive second-half surge.
  • Senior guard Deyton Albury added 15 points with a perfect 8-for-8 at the line and three steals in an efficient all-court display.
  • Antonio Chol's steal-and-dunk ignited an 8-0 first-half burst that helped build a 31-19 halftime lead and control the tempo.
  • UT Arlington shot 35.3% from the field and 3-for-25 from three, yet won the boards 38-30 behind Raysean Seamster's 17 points and nine rebounds.
  • The Lobos logged 14 steals after posting 11 in their opener, marking their most through two games since 2017 and their second straight opponent with 21-plus turnovers and sub-36% shooting.
